ACL and MCL tear surgery right knee
Recently underwent an ACL reconstruction surgery along with MCL repair for the same knee. 3.5 weeks post op. When I try to bend my knee. after straight leg exercises( towel press under the knee and the ankle), my knee locks up. It only lasts for a second and all I have to do is relax my leg and then I can bend it. But there is a popping sound with a very mild pain when I bend it the first time after the straight leg pressing exercises. After that I can bend it normally. Is it normal?

This might be sure to femoral endobutton pressing on IT band..or some other surgical component impinging on knee structures. Also it is possible if you have a meniscal tear that has not been dealt with.
